Lactase Units per Caplet
Choosing the right lactase units per caplet is vital for effectively managing lactose intolerance. We'll find that most formulations contain between 3000 to 9000 FCC units per caplet. A higher number usually means better relief from symptoms when we consume dairy. Many users report needing around 9000 FCC units per meal for ideal results, so we may need to adjust the number of caplets based on our personal tolerance levels. It's also important to take into account the lactase unit concentration relative to the total caplets in a package to assess overall value and effectiveness. Different brands offer varying concentrations, affecting how many caplets we need for similar relief. Let's keep these factors in mind as we make our choice!
Dosage Recommendations
To effectively manage lactose intolerance, we should consider specific dosage recommendations for Lactaid Lactose Intolerance Relief Caplets. It's generally recommended to take up to three caplets with the first bite or sip of dairy to prevent discomfort. Each caplet contains 9000 FCC lactase units, which is usually sufficient for breaking down lactose in a meal. Some of us find better results by taking one caplet before and another during dairy consumption, allowing us to tailor our dosage based on individual tolerance. For larger meals or substantial dairy products, we might need to adjust the dosage, possibly requiring multiple caplets. Since effectiveness can vary, experimenting with the number of caplets can help us find our ideal relief.

Price per Use
Evaluating the price per use of Lactaid lactose intolerance relief caplets is essential for making an informed choice. We need to take into account the dosage required for effective relief, as some products may necessitate multiple caplets, which can greatly influence the overall cost. Typically, around 9,000 FCC lactase units are needed per meal, sometimes requiring three caplets instead of just one. This variation can lead to differing costs per use among brands. Additionally, larger bottles often provide better value, reducing the price per use when compared to smaller packages. By comparing the total number of caplets in a bottle against the suggested dosage, we can determine the most cost-effective options for long-term use.
